vim: Improve lifecycle (#16477)
Closes #13579 A major painpoint in the Vim crate has been life-cycle management. We used to have one global Vim instance that tried to track per-editor state; this led to a number of subtle issues (e.g. #13579, the mode indicator being global, and quick toggling between windows letting vim mode's notion of the active editor get out of sync). This PR changes the internal structure of the code so that there is now one `Vim` instance per `Editor` (stored as an `Addon`); and the global stuff is separated out. This fixes the above problems, and tidies up a bunch of the mess in the codebase. Release Notes: * vim: Fixed accidental visual mode in project search and go to references ([#13579](https://github.com/zed-industries/zed/issues/13579)).

workspace: Improve error handling when dropping a file that cannot be opened into the workspace pane (#15613)
This PR can improve the UX when dropping a file that cannot be opened into the workspace pane. Previously, nothing happened without any messages when such error occurred, which could be awkward for users. Additionally the pane was being split even though the file failed to open. Here's a screen recording demonstrating the previous/updated behavior: https://github.com/user-attachments/assets/cfdf3488-9464-4568-b16a-9b87718bd729 Changes: - It now displays an error message if a file cannot be opened. - Updated the logic to first try to open the file. The pane splits only if the file opening process is successful. Release Notes: - Improved error handling when opening files in the workspace pane. An error message will now be displayed if the file cannot be opened. - Fixed an issue where unnecessary pane splitting occurred when a file fails to open.

f7f7cd5
repl: Don't prefix free variables with `_` (#16494)
This PR is a small refactor to remove the leading `_` for some free variables, as this unintentionally marks them as unused to the compiler. While the fields on the struct _are_ unused, the free variables should participate in usage tracking, as we want to make sure they get stored on the struct. Release Notes: - N/A
